The size of Australind is approximately 23.2 square kilometres. There are 22 parks, covering nearly 17.5% of the total area. The population of Australind in 2016 was 14539 people. By 2021 the population was 15988 showing a population growth of 10.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Australind is 0-9 years. Households in Australind are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Australind work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 76.50% of the homes in Australind were owner-occupied compared with 74.10% in 2016.
